Area L AHEC Located in Rocky Mount, Area L AHEC is one of nine centers in the NC AHEC Program and serves Edgecombe, Halifax, Nash, Northampton, and Wilson counties..

Area L AHEC provides and supports educational activities and services with a focus on primary care in rural communities and those with less access to resources to recruit, train, and retain the workforce needed to create a healthy North Carolina. We are very excited to welcome our summer intern, Braylie Phillips! Braylie is coming to us through the Interns for Impact program offered by the Healthcare Foundation of Wilson and will be with us through July! She attended Rocky Mount High School, has just finished her first year at UNC Chapel Hill where she is pursuing a chemistry degree, and desires to work in research focusing on health disparities. Braylie will be assisting our Director of Health Careers and Workforce Development, Jordan Blake, with various health career exposure initiatives and program development! Welcome, Braylie!

An additional thank you to the Healthcare Foundation of Wilson for making this connection possible! The Interns for Impact initiative connects local college students with non-profit organizations to provide professional development opportunities and meaningful work experiences that focus on social good within the community!

Congratulations to Felissa Wellman, a social worker with Wilson County Schools, who won a ONEBox while attending the Mind & Body: Addressing Adolescent Substance Use and Mental Health Conference earlier this month!

The ONEbox is an emergency opioid overdose reversal kit designed to promote safety by assuring that individuals have life-saving, on-demand training when and where they need it.

When asked about her experience at the program she stated, "This seminar completely changed my view on recovery, instead of just focusing on the behavioral aspect of any addiction. It provided tools to heal the mind and body connection. I left today feeling empowered and with a better understanding on how to assist the students and community I serve."
